Mysql
 sql >> Base de Dados >  >> RDS >> Mysql

Acessando o banco de dados MySql do arquivo PHP no host local


Apenas certifique-se de que você está usando uma credencial válida, se tudo estiver certo, dê uma olhada nestes:

Erro com um arquivo .htaccess

Se você estiver usando um .htaccess em seu site, ele pode estar interferindo na página da web que você está tentando carregar em seu navegador. Por favor, verifique a configuração do .htaccess. Qualquer erro de sintaxe fará com que uma mensagem 500 Internal Server Error seja exibida em vez de seu site.

Para confirmar se um .htaccess de configuração incorreta é a causa do erro 500 Internal Server, remova ou renomeie o arquivo .htaccess temporariamente e tente recarregar a página.

Veja também:

Usando regras de reescrita .htaccessUsando arquivos .htaccess

Tempo limite de codificação PHP

Se o seu script PHP faz conexões de rede externas, as conexões podem expirar. Se muitas conexões forem tentadas e atingirem o tempo limite, isso causará um "500 Internal Server Error". Para evitar esses tempos limite e erros, você deve certificar-se de que os scripts PHP sejam codificados com algumas regras de tempo limite. Normalmente, no entanto, é difícil detectar um erro de tempo limite ao conectar-se a um banco de dados ou externamente a recursos remotos (exemplo:feeds RSS). Eles, na verdade, impedem que o script continue a ser executado.

A remoção de qualquer conexão externa pode aumentar o desempenho do seu site e diminuir as chances de você receber um "500 Internal Server Error".

O erro 500 do servidor interno não é uma falha de cliente ou site/web...